Blue Transition is a project within the Interreg North Sea Region programme that aims to bring about systematic change, a “blue transition”, through integrated water and soil management. Climate adapted water management system to prevent saltwater intrusion and desiccation of organic loam with the associated CO2 submission at the Luneplate.
This is one of the 16 pilots in Blue Transition which aims to Balanced water and land use to minimize the effect of climate change on groundwater and soil.


 

This is one example of how transnational projects deliver tangible benefits on the ground, and solutions ready to be scaled and replicated elsewhere. Blue Transition is running 16 pilots in six countries, exploring a range of aspects. Stay tuned for more pilot project videos!
